pleurocarpous moss pleurocarpous moss
pleurocarpous moss A type of moss in which archegonia, and hence capsules, are borne on short, lateral branches, and not at the tips of stems or branches. Pleurocarpous mosses are usually monopodially branched, often pinnately so, and tend to form spreading carpets rather than erect tufts. Compare... Read more

Iceland Moss Iceland Moss
Iceland moss Description Iceland moss (Cetraria islandica ) is a lichen (a moss-like plant) that grows on the ground in mountains, forests, and arctic areas. In addition to Iceland, the lichen is found in Scandinavia, Great Britain, North America, Russia, and other areas in the Northern... Read more
